A Cook County jury on Thursday awarded more than $19 million to the estate of a man who died in a truck collision on the side of an interstate.Jesse Inman’s estate sued truck companies Howe Freightways Inc. and Hiner Transport LLC in 2012, alleging Howe failed to contact a tow company to help its stalled employee, caused a Hiner-operated semitrailer truck to trigger a multitruck and multifatality collision in September 2011.Howe employee James Langholf was traveling westbound on Interstate 80 near Grinnell, Iowa …
